    Quote Originally Posted by XTOUR View Post
    What do you guys find the biggest difference?
    With me it is more the mental side of things. I find myself thinking more about shots & what I want to do on that particular hole instead of just playing golf. When I make a mistake or have a bad shot, it hurts more because I know each strokes counts, and it is harder to get back. Its easy to get down on oneself. This past weekend I had a little break through and was able to turn things around on the back 9. Hopefully I can transition this experience to future tournament rounds and not take so long to get back on the straight and narrow.

    Scotty, as for what's different, the biggest difference for me was that every shot counts and you only get one go at it. I'm used to playing matchplay or stableford tourneys, where if you screw up one hole you're still alive. Well, I found out at smugglers that one hole can easily knock you out of the tournament, so you have to play more conservatively, maybe not go for some pins, or hit a fairway wood off the tee on some holes... You just can't have any lapses if you want to be in contention. I must say it opened a whole new dimension to golf that I never really saw before, and it's a lot of fun!
